Do you know how to check for invalid syntax in an HTML file? I'm using ember.js with syntastic plugin vim plugin and it is producing warnings that make me confused.

That code is invalid because <script> is not supposed to contain any other HTML tag.

:help syntastic shows how to disable syntax checking for a given filetype:

let g:syntastic_mode_map={ 'mode': 'active',
                     \ 'active_filetypes': [],
                     \ 'passive_filetypes': ['html'] }
